Transaction 344273e3475d6d87fce6f6f8090573996e82a0d00026c6e54d2f3023445203f3

1 Input
2 Outputs
  • 344273e3475d6d87fce6f6f8090573996e82a0d00026c6e54d2f3023445203f3:0
  • value  600000
    address  1XxpjPafVgxe8EgS8Ab8yMWCvX6KY3pgR
  • 344273e3475d6d87fce6f6f8090573996e82a0d00026c6e54d2f3023445203f3:1
  • value  1385813103
    address  13SMgDfyQzBwSqvWfAaEPYLfiVy2e1FbRr